Fast food is characterized by an imbalanced nutritional content. Most are high in calories, but very low in fiber. Fast food is a major factor affecting obesity. Based on the 2013 Riskesdas the prevalence of obesity was 28.9%, while the results of the 2018 Riskesdas data showed that the prevalence of obesity had reached 52.8%. Based on these data, it is known that there is an increase in obesity cases by 1.36%. The purpose of this study was to determine the relationship between fast food consumption and obesity in adolescents. This research method uses analytical research design with a cross sectional approach. The sampling technique used accidental sampling with a total of 94 samples calculated using the Slovin formula. The research instrument used a questionnaire, research sites in vocational high schools in Indramayu District in 2019. The analysis used univariate and bivariate analysis was carried out by using the Chi-Square Test. The results of this study indicate that there is an effect between consumption of fast food and the incidence of obesity with a value of P = 0.000. The next researcher should examine family support and the school environment for fast food consumption behavior in teenagers.
